🔍 What Does the Seed Tag Mean?
Projects listed with a Seed Tag are typically newer and more experimental. While they may offer strong upside opportunities, they also come with higher volatility and risk. Traders are required to pass a risk awareness quiz before trading Seed Tag assets on Binance.
